The Copyright Act was completely reworked in 1977-78, resulting in the
Copyright Act of 1978. Anything you learned about copyright before 1978 is
obsolete and should be deleted. Anything you hear about copyright from a
friend is wrong and should be ignored. You can get all of the information, a
copy of the Act, and rules for filing copyrights free for the asking from
the Copyright Office in Washington DC. They are in the phone book.
